April Bowlby
April Bowlby has been an American actor and model for over 20 years. She has been known for her role as Kandi on the CBS comedy show Two and a Half Men Stacy Barrett on Drop Dead Diva as well as Rita Farr on Titans and Doom Patrol. April Michelle Bowlby was born in New York City. Her most well-known role is for her roles as Stacy Barrett and Kandi on Two and a Half Men and Drop Dead Diva, a comedy series that is a legal, fantasy drama and comedy. She began her career in modeling and moved onto films and TV series. The first time she appeared was on a small screen, as an actor in the TV series CSI: Crime Scene Investigation. The show was followed by appearances in one-off episodes on other shows. Her breakthrough performance was Kandi, in Two and a Half Men. Bowlby is well-known around the globe for her role she played Stacy Barrett in Drop Dead Diva. She was the main character of the character Rita Farr/Elastigirl on the American web-based show Titans. She will be reprising her character in a spinoff of The Doom Patrol series. Bowlby has also been seen on TV in movies like Sands of Oblivion, The Wrong Daughter and Sands of Oblivion 2. The actress made her debut on the big screen in All Roads Lead Home, then appeared on the screen in The Slammin Salmon as well as From Prada to Nada. Bowlby was a student at East Union High School in Manteca in California. The school was her first move to California when she was a child. She first studied French and Ballet at Moorpark College. Then she determined to study acting. She studied with Ivana Chaubbuck, and was offered a part in a television series (Kandi, Two and a Half Men) several months following she had her Hollywood audition. Bowlby is well-known for her roles on a variety of TV shows, including CSI (as Kaitlin in 2004), CSI: NY (as Jenny Lee in 2006), Freddie: Sydney in 2005 and the show Stacked as Jasmine 2007 and How I Met Your Mother: Meg in 2007.
